1-Month Paid Legal Internship by Department of Legal Affairs – Apply by June 11

The Department of Legal Affairs, under the Ministry of Law and Justice, Government of India, is inviting applications for its prestigious 1-month paid legal internship program. This opportunity is designed for 50 law students and recent graduates to gain valuable experience working directly with legal professionals and policy advisors in a real government environment.

The internship will take place across five major Indian cities — New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ata, Chennai, and Bengaluru — providing regional access to students from different parts of the country. The program aims to expose interns to legal research, drafting, and the inner workings of legal advisory processes within the government.

This is an ideal opportunity for aspiring legal professionals who want to understand the scope of legal work in the public sector, particularly in legislative matters and legal advisory services.


Internship Overview

  • Duration: 1 month
  • Type: Paid internship
  • Stipend: Amount not officially specified, but remuneration is provided
  • Cities: New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ata, Chennai, Bengaluru
  • Total Positions Available: 50
  • Application Deadline: June 11, 2025

Interns will be placed in different divisions of the Department of Legal Affairs and work on tasks involving legal documentation, analysis of statutes, and support in ongoing legal affairs managed by the Ministry.


Who Can Apply?

Eligible candidates include:

  • Law students enrolled in the 2nd year or above of a 5-year integrated LLB program.
  • Final-year students pursuing a 3-year LLB degree.
  • LLM students and law graduates who have completed their course and are not currently employed full-time.

Applicants must have a strong academic background and a keen interest in public legal policy, constitutional law, and statutory interpretation. This internship is particularly valuable for those looking to work in the field of legislative drafting, legal advisory, or government law services.


Application Requirements

Applicants must submit the following:

  1. Updated resume/CV with academic and contact details.
  2. A No Objection Certificate (NOC) from their college or university, stating:
    • The applicant is a bonafide student.
    • The institution has no objection to the student joining the internship.
    • The student is not attending other academic sessions during the internship.
  3. Government-issued ID proof.
  4. Academic transcripts or mark sheets (if requested).

The NOC must be issued on institutional letterhead and signed by the HOD or Principal.


Internship Terms and Conduct

Selected interns are expected to:

  • Maintain punctuality and be present in the office from 9:00 AM to 5:30 PM on all working days.
  • Adhere to the official dress code: black trousers, white shirt, blazer (in winter), and black formal shoes.
  • Follow professional and ethical conduct, including strict confidentiality.

Interns must sign a Non-Disclosure Agreement (NDA) before beginning their tenure. This ensures that all government data, reports, and internal discussions remain confidential. Interns are strictly prohibited from disclosing any internal material or using it for personal purposes.

They must also bring their own laptops with internet access, as most work will be conducted digitally.


Rules and Restrictions

Interns must:

  • Report to their designated officer daily and maintain a signed attendance record.
  • Seek prior approval for any leave.
  • Avoid unauthorized access to files, systems, or confidential data.
  • Refrain from using departmental resources for personal purposes.

Violation of any of these conditions may lead to termination of the internship and further disciplinary actions.

General Corporate Law Internship June 2025 Metalaw – Remote Legal Role Open Now

General Corporate Law Internship June 2025 Metalaw is an exclusive opportunity for aspiring legal professionals to gain valuable corporate law experience in a real-world environment. Metalaw, a well-regarded law firm in India, is offering only one remote internship for June 2025 in its General Corporate and Commercial Law Team.

This internship is best suited for law students currently in their penultimate or final year who are serious about learning and capable of contributing meaningfully in a professional setting. If you’re aiming to build a career in corporate advisory, contract law, or commercial transactions, this one-month internship at Metalaw offers focused exposure, mentorship, and experience.

Internship Overview

  • Title: Legal Intern – General Corporate and Commercial Law
  • Duration: 1 Month (June 2025)
  • Mode: Remote / Work From Home
  • Team: General Corporate and Commercial Law
  • Openings: Only 1 intern will be selected

This internship involves assisting the team with legal research, drafting commercial contracts, internal policy reviews, and working on client advisories.

Eligibility Criteria

Applicants for the General Corporate Law Internship June 2025 Metalaw must meet the following criteria:

  • Be in their penultimate or final year of a 3-year or 5-year law program
  • Have a genuine interest in corporate and commercial legal work
  • Be able to dedicate time sincerely to complete assigned tasks on time
  • Possess good written English and legal research skills
  • Be self-motivated and comfortable working in a remote setup

This internship is ideal for individuals who want personalized mentorship and are eager to apply their academic knowledge in a professional setting.

How to Apply

To apply for the General Corporate Law Internship June 2025 Metalaw, follow these steps:

  1. Prepare an updated CV highlighting relevant coursework and skills
  2. Draft a brief cover email clearly stating your interest in corporate law and availability in June
  3. Send your application to careers@metalaw.co.in

Important Guidelines:

  • Do not send DMs or direct messages on LinkedIn or other social platforms
  • Only shortlisted candidates will be contacted by the Metalaw Hiring Team for further rounds via phone

What You Will Gain

By joining the General Corporate Law Internship June 2025 Metalaw, you can expect:

  • Exposure to real-world corporate legal work
  • Involvement in tasks such as research, drafting, and commercial due diligence
  • Experience in reviewing contracts and client advisories
  • Mentorship from experienced legal professionals
  • A unique chance to intern in a 1:1 setting, ensuring focused learning

This internship is not just a learning experience but also a test of how well you can perform in a practical corporate law environment.

Application Deadline

There is no formal deadline, but since only one intern will be selected, applications are being reviewed on a rolling basis. Candidates are advised to apply as soon as possible to increase their chances of being considered.
